Executive Overview
It has been my privilege to serve as Amgen’s chief executive officer since 2012 and as its chairman since 2013. I joined Amgen in 2006 in Operations, a great place to learn the company from the ground up. I became chief financial officer in 2007 and president and chief operating officer in 2010. Prior to Amgen, I spent nearly two decades as an investment banker at Morgan Stanley – many of those years in London – where I worked mostly with health care clients. Amgen is a true American success story. The company was founded in 1980 as Applied Molecular Genetics by three biotechnology entrepreneurs who set up shop in Thousand Oaks, California. More than 40 years later, Amgen is still headquartered in Thousand Oaks – and our original building still stands – but we’ve grown to become one of the largest and most successful biotech companies in the world with 2023 sales of more than $28 billion and some 27,000 employees. In August 2020, Amgen became one of the 30 companies included in the Dow Jones Industrial Average. All of us at Amgen are inspired by the same mission: to serve patients. Our portfolio includes 25 medicines for cancer, heart disease, migraine, osteoporosis, autoimmune disorders, and other serious illnesses that affect hundreds of millions of people and cost society hundreds of billions of dollars. We’ve invested nearly $19 billion in research and development over the last five years, utilizing industry-leading human genetics capabilities to inform our efforts to find new medicines.
